rubbish
ˈrʌbɪʃ n.
1 refuse, waste, debris, rubble, detritus, litter, garbage, sweepings, dross, dregs,
residue, leftovers, remnants, lees, scraps, fragments, leavings, residuum, junk, rejects,
Chiefly US trash Slang chiefly US dreck: Private companies are now contracted to remove household
rubbish weekly.
2 (stuff and) nonsense, balderdash, moonshine, gibberish, gobbledegook or gobbledygook,
tommy-rot, bunkum, trash, garbage, twaddle, Colloq rot, flapdoodle, crap, hokum, codswallop, bosh,
piffle, hooey, bunk, malarkey, poppycock, boloney or baloney, eyewash, hogwash, bilge-water,
bull, Scots havers, Brit tosh, gammon, US a crock, horse feathers, gurry, Slang rot, Brit (a
load of (old)) cobblers, Taboo slang bullshit, horseshit, US a crock of shit: What she told
you about how I treated her is absolute rubbish. --v.
3 criticize, attack, destroy, Colloq clobber, pan, Chiefly US trash, Slang jump on,
Chiefly US and Canadian bad-mouth, jump all over: In his latest book he rubbishes the newspaper
that had given his previous book a bad review.
